Safety

Important Safety Instructions

S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S - This manual contains
important instructions that should be followed during
installation, operation, and maintenance of the product.
Save this manual for future reference.
This is the safety alert symbol. When you see this
symbol on your pump or in this manual, look for one of
the following signal words and be alert to the potential
for personal injury!
indicates a hazard which, if not avoided, will
result in death or serious injury.
indicates a hazard which, if not avoided,
could result in death or serious injury.
indicates a hazard which, if not avoided,
could result in minor or moderate injury.
NOTICE addresses practices not related to personal injury.
Carefully read and follow all safety instructions in this
manual and on pump .
Keep safety labels in good condition.
Replace missing or damaged safety labels.
1. Read this manual carefully. Failure to follow these
instructions could cause serious bodily injury and/or
property damage.
2. Check your local codes before installing. You must
comply with their rules.
3. Vent sewage or septic tank according to local codes.
4. Do not install pump in any location classified
as hazardous by National Electrical Code,
ANSI/NFPA 70. Do not smoke or use electrical
devices which could generate sparks or flame
in an atmosphere which could contain septic
(methane) gas.
Hazardous voltage . Can shock, burn or
cause death. During operation, the pump is in water.
To avoid fatal shocks, proceed as follows if pump
needs servicing:
5A. Disconnect power to outlet box before
unplugging pump.
5B. Take extreme care when changing fuses. Do not
stand in water or put your finger in fuse socket.
5C. Do not modify cord and plug. Plug into a grounded
outlet only. If the system is not properly grounded
or you are not sure, call a licensed electrician for

assistance. Installation and checking of all electrical
circuits and hardware should be performed only by a
qualified licensed electrician.
5D. Make certain that the pump's power cord will reach
the ground fault interrupter protected receptacle
or control box. Do not use an extension cord with
this system.
5E. Connect this pump to a 15 amp circuit breaker on a
dedicated circuit.
6. Do not run pump dry. Dry running can overheat
pump, (causing burns to anyone handling it) and will
void warranty.
7. Pump normally runs hot. To avoid burns when
servicing pump, allow it to cool for 20 minutes after
shut-down before handling it.
8. In normal service, motor should not need oiling.
Motor has been filled at the factory with a
special oil.

Pre-Installation

1. Inspect all materials before accepting them. Hidden
damage can occur during shipment. If the unit is
found to be damaged after opening the box, return it
to the dealer from whom you bought it.
2. Before installation or operation carefully read all the
information provided with this product. Familiarize
yourself with specific details regarding installation
and use before attempting the installation.
There is a separate owner's manual for the system's pump
(publication FP937). Refer to that manual for information
about operation and maintenance of the pump that is
provided with this system.
NOTICE: This pumping unit is designed to lift sewage
up to a maximum of 15 feet total, including friction loss
from pipe and fittings. Do not use the Add-a-Jon in an
installation requiring that the pump lift sewage more
than 15 feet. Note that as lift increases, flow decreases;
the higher the lift, the longer it will take to pump out the
system's tank.
NOTICE: Floor Seal: Do not use a wax seal having a
flange that extends into the tank; it may cause clogging.
If a floor is installed over the tank, use a floor-flange-
extender seal-kit designed by the toilet manufacturer.
